Childhood is the best time to make different perceptions and beliefs and you would want it to be as balanced as possible for the betterment of your child. We live in a country that is as diversified as it can get. It becomes an added responsibility for the parents to make a child understand what are different cultures and their traditions. It is convenient if parents start the practice of teaching at the right time because once a child forms a belief in his/her head, it becomes difficult to change it. Also, different cultures have different lessons for your child that teach moral values, life lessons and offer a variety in lifestyle. Your child can get fascinated by several practices of different cultures and get indulged in different festivals that have different traditions. You can teach a lot from each one of them and build curiosity in a child related to the history of a particular culture. Giving them practical experiences would be great for their learning as it is easy for them to learn by visualizing things. Preschools can be a great space for your child to witness different traditions and lifestyles. As they would learn and grow, they would also learn a lot about different cultures through their peers and teachers.

These practices can turn helpful for you in making your child understand the diversified cultural values:

Preparing different food items

Food is close to everyone’s heart. The cravings for different varieties of food can be utilized to a good effect by the parents. You can eat different varieties of food that are being eaten in different cultures. While your kid eats that food, you can tell a lesson about the culture or how that food originated. Amidst this practice, your kids might get their favorite meal that they would continue eating for the rest of their lives. You can take help from your friends or neighbors who belong to different backgrounds and cultures. Also, you can search for different recipes on the internet and try one every week.

Making them learn several languages 

Languages vary from state to state and sometimes city to city in our country. Every language has its origin and history, which can be an interesting lesson for your child. Knowing about different languages not only sharpens the brain but gives your child a brief about different traditions associated with a particular culture. You can start by translating some of the commonly used words like sorry and thank you in different languages. In today’s world, you can translate one language into hundreds of languages using the internet. This can turn out to be an interactive and meaningful practice for the cognitive growth of your child. Preschools work on such basics from the beginning.

Listen to a variety of traditional music 

Music is fun, especially for the kids when they sing along, dance, and clap on the beats. It can be a great learning experience that comes with entertainment. When your child listens to some traditional music of different cultures it can bring a mixture of language, emotions, musical sense, different instruments, and genres. Singe can bring a lot of curiosity inside your child and you can answer questions like, what does it mean? From where the singer is? What culture does he/she represent? Even nursery schools try to get a child to indulge in music from the start.

Glimpses of traditional clothing or design 

A glimpse of different attires and designs is enough for your child to know and recognize different cultures. That is the power of cultural values in our country. You can select different designs and attire and teach your child about the relevant culture. You can even buy them different dresses to have some experience of it. 

A holiday to diversified locations 

A trip to any particular place every season can bring lots of teachings to your child. When your child looks at people having the same kind of attires, eating the same kind of food, using the same language, then it becomes easy for them to understand the whole culture and its different traditions. Preschools usually teach about different cultures early to a child by using geographical location on a map.

Being shy is an element that you will find common in many individuals around you. However, there are two aspects to every characteristic but shyness sometimes limits a child more than anything. Every parent would want their child to convey their feelings and explore as much as possible. Also, to enjoy the jollification of childhood, it is feasible to ask as many questions as possible and set yourself free with your loved ones. It becomes the responsibility of the parents to give space and a mindset that the kids feel free to be an extrovert. Childhood is raw and can be molded into any shape. Once your child grows it would be hard to change his/her characteristics and habits. It becomes difficult to socialize and make new friends easily. It is seen as a drawback rather than an asset for any child. At the same time, parents should understand that everyone has their way of conveying their emotions. You would want your kid to grow but they can take their time to settle and adapt to changes. Just start working on the habits on time to give the best childhood to your kid. You can seek help from preschools who have expertise in treating kids in the way they want.

Here are a few ways that you can use for dealing with shy kids:

Don’t label your kid with names 

Remember you should not make children feel again and again that they are shy or they are lacking in any way from others. It is completely natural to be like this and some brainstorming would work better. Calling your kid shy regularly, especially in public would leave a mark on their mind and it would turn out more difficult to come out of that phase. Labeling them with names would work as an excuse for children and they would not put in efforts to improve the situation. It sometimes turns embarrassing for children in public which is very much unhealthy for their mental state. Rather than using shyness as an excuse, start working on the process and you will find adequate results soon. Get help from the preschool of your child.

Remember shyness doesn’t symbolize weakness 

Being shy is never a setback unless you hype the other side too much. Never pressurize your kid to speak fluently in public or to socialize quickly. Things take time and your kid is still a young lad who needs proper love and care. It can be frustrating for you sometimes but that is the test for you. Deal with patience and never make your kid realize that he/she is failing in a way by not socializing much. Shyness sometimes works as a great tool because shy people think before they speak. But, at the same time, they are too hesitant to say what is on their mind. The balance in between should be the goal for every parent. Nursery schools try to bring in that balance through their activities.

Prepare your kid for new things

Shyness is many times restricted to a time. When your kid gets used to a place or a person, he/she becomes friendly. It is easier for them to communicate and be comfortable. In such cases, you can prepare your kid for a new place or thing before the change. Even involving them with new friends can be a great method of teaching them the right ways to communicate and engage with new people. It builds their confidence and call-offs shyness. This is the reason why preschools are a must for toddlers, they learn from the base how to socialize and excel to their capabilities.

Seek opportunities to know their feelings

Kids who are introverts are hesitant in expressing what they feel. That feeling increases with time and they would never really open up their heart after that. Parents should find ways from the beginning to know what their child feels, it can be through direct communication or indirectly. The feeling of speaking their heart out would give them relaxation and they will want to express their thoughts regularly. Such practices from early childhood would help well in vanishing the shyness within a child.

It is natural to get bothered about your children when they can’t remember things for long. But it is not natural to pressurize them to do the same. There are ways to boost the memory power of your kid and it is convenient if you work on such activities from the base. Your child may be a slow learner but you need not worry about it. Everyone has their own ways and it is important that you focus on individual growth rather than comparing your kid with others. There are several factors behind memory strength, like, many kids might not be able to think in different directions at a point. Similarly, many kids think before they speak and find it difficult to do both at a time. It is to be noted that there is no need to worry about such things, rather parents should start a process and try to fix it by adopting certain brainstorming activities. Preschools are known for doing the same, they conduct activities and monitor the capabilities within a child, not to distinguish between them but to know which child needs what kinds of space to develop.

Here are some tips to foster the memory power of your child:

 

Let them visualize as much as possible 

Visualization is one of the most important practices to push your brain limits to its expansion. When your child visualizes different scenarios, you get to know his/her point of view and at the same time, you can judge what are capabilities within him/her. Art and craft are perfect examples of that, you can consider different real-life objects or situations and ask your kid to draw them afterward. It can help in determining what your child is thinking and how much of the real event and object does he/she remember. The practice of visualizing will help them memorize things and continually remembering it would work as a revision. Just make sure you don’t force anything on the child as it might work negatively. Just remember everyone takes their own time, especially when they are in the growing stage like preschoolers.

Indulge them in some visual memory games

Games are fun and they can be more productive than normal activities too. Make your child perform activities like remembering countries’ capitals and finding them on a map. Before that, make sure you give them complete education and guide them on the same. There are other ways that the schools use, but you should know what your child’s limitations are. Never force them to read or learn anything that is not understandable to them. It can be frustrating and would form a habit of mugging up in them. You would want your child to memorize everything practically and know the logical reason behind it. The preschools are built around such activities and that is the reason for their popularity among new parents.

Let your child Teach you 

This can be a very interesting and result-oriented practice for improving your child’s memory strength. Ask your child to teach whatever the teacher has taught him/her in the school. This would also give you an idea of what changes you need in the functioning of the teaching and what you need from your kid’s teachers. You can focus on the trend of whether the kid is forgetting things. Also, it would work as revision for the child and it would turn easy for them to memorize. The activities could be like asking your kid to teach you a new game that he/she learned in school recently. Try to make it as frequent as possible for your kid. Every preschool has the space to conduct such activities, make sure you choose the right one.

Promote active reading and cut information into pieces

It’s never easy to learn in bulk, especially for new learners. Try to make the information as short as possible and if everything’s important then chunk it into smaller groups so that the child can find it easy. Active reading means explaining everything and highlighting the important parts of the read. It helps in memorizing to a great extent. Schools that deal with kids have a close look at every child’s growth and promote these practices for them.

Crying for children is a normal thing, especially for toddlers who are not capable of speaking fluently or communicating feelings to their parents. It is frustrating for the parents, especially when they don’t’ know the reason for the wipe. It can be hard but being parents, you should know that parenting is all about taking responsibility and enjoying each action with your child. Kids who are learning to speak can’t convey the reasons making it a challenge for the parents. But, even when the kid starts the verbal expression it can be tricky to understand the reason for the adults as the kids have their own opinions and ways to look at things. Sometimes, you should let your kid cry their heart out but on other days if it is too much you should get serious and do something about it. Above all, you should do you bit to know the reason and take some actions according to it.

To know the reasons for your kid crying, you can take references from the following pointers

Your Child needs feeding 

The basic thing a child wants is food or mother’s milk. If the child is grown enough to be in a preschool, still he/she might not be able to communicate facts. Food can work wonderfully well to calm down a crying child. Kids don’t eat much but require some feeding in three to four hours. Even if the child is not saying to eat, your feeding can relax him and make a crying child quiet. Even the preschoolers have the tendency of hesitating in asking for food, but the preschools know it better. They know that a happy stomach would lead to better activities and learning for the kid.

Your Child is too busy

When kids start their schooling, they undergo a lot of changes, socially, mentally, and physically as well. Change is never easy to adapt to when you are that young. The busy schedule might get disturbing and the child wouldn’t be aware of it because of the lack of awareness. The activities and work at a school will be tiring in the beginning and homework, playing and home schedule would turn into a mess. The parents need to analyze and understand on their behalf how much load is suitable for the kid. The reason is never directly visible, you would have to seek options and help your child through numerous ways.

Your Child is Stressed

Children are too young to understand the term stress, but humans experience that term from their birth. The anxiety that going away from the parents gives, might be stressful for the child. The kid again would not have an idea what he/she is going through. You should regularly communicate and try to take out the feelings that lie within your child. There can be different kinds of stress, like adapting to the change, or behavior of others around the kid, etc. That is the reason why preschools keep it easy for the kid in the beginning and offer joyful activities that relieve the child regularly. If your kid is not ready for preschool, look for reasons that are stressful and try to keep him/her away from such things as much as possible.

Your child wants attention or a change

When kids are attached to you they want your attention all the time. Toddlers are smart enough to know that crying is the best way to rag attention towards them. They might need you to play with them or they might not want you to go away. Also, when a kid is tired of a toy or a place then he/she starts crying. It is a signal that a change is needed. This is some healthy and cute crying but make sure you change it as soon as possible before it turns into a habit. Such a habit would be concerning going ahead and the child would get stubborn too. The preschoolers who develop such habits offer difficulties to the parents as they don’t want to be away from them.

It is common for children to break the rules and go against the norm to ‘test’ authority. Only that way do they understand what behavior is appropriate and what is not. We shall talk about the behaviors that kids tend to exhibit from time to time and how we can handle a child with behavior problems. Children are cute when naughty. A few tantrums, arguments, and yelling once in a while are not abnormal. But if such behavior becomes a daily occurrence, then it is a cause for concern. In general, a kid’s behavior is deemed to be normal if it is socially, developmentally, and culturally appropriate. You can consider a child’s behavior normal even if it does not meet societal or cultural expectations, but is otherwise age-appropriate and not harmful. Here are some common signs that you might observe in your child’s behavior during early childhood.

Child behavior concerns in the preschool years 

Anxiety

Anxiety is a normal part of children’s development, and preschoolers often fear things like being on their own or being in the dark. If your child worries too much or shows signs of anxiety, you can support her by acknowledging her fear, gently encouraging her to do things she’s anxious about, and praising her when she does. If anxiety is affecting your child’s life, see your doctor anytime soon. Going to school can cause anxiety for the children since they move out from the safe environment of the home to a different unfamiliar environment.

Bullying 

Bullying can be devastating for children’s confidence and self-esteem, especially in the preschool years. If your child is being bullied at preschool, she needs lots of love and support, both at home and at preschool. She also needs to know that you’ll take action to prevent any further bullying.

Fighting

Disagreements and fighting among children are very common. A few factors affect fighting like temperament, environment, age, and skills. You can work with these factors to handle fighting in your family. 

Habits 

Lots of children have habits, like biting nails or twirling hair. Your child’s habits might bother you, but usually, it’s nothing to worry about. Most habits go away by themselves when they learn good manners and some skills at a kids’ school or home.

Lying 

You might have caught your child telling the occasional lie. Lying is part of development, and it often starts around three years of age. It’s usually better to teach young children the value of honesty and telling the truth than to punish them for small lies. Nursery Schools will help you in that case, they teach moral values to a kid from scratch.

Shyness 

Shy behavior is normal in preschoolers. If your child is slow to warm up, try to support her in social situations. For example, you could stay at preschool for a while in the mornings during the early days. It’s also good to praise your child for brave social behavior, like responding to others, using eye contact, or playing away from you.

Tantrums

If your child throws tantrums, it might help to remember that he’s still learning appropriate ways to express feelings. If you work on reducing your child’s stress, tuning into your child’s feelings, and spotting your child’s tantrum triggers, you should see fewer tantrums after he turns four.

When to get serious about such behavior? 

In case abnormal behaviors turn into something unmanageable at home, or if your child is making a mistake repeatedly, it is time for you to see a doctor. There could be a deeper reason for him to behave in a certain way. The professional will look into the physical and mental health of the child before recommending medications, special therapy, or counseling. Under what circumstances could the child’s behavior become out of control? You can even contact your kids’ preschool to know whether the child repeatedly behaves the same at the school as well.

What Can Parents Do?

Don’t be hyper about your child’s development. Just behave normally and they will grow into normal, well-adjusted adults. Next time your child misbehaves, just remember that you are the mature person in the relationship and be calm and gentle. All hurdles will automatically get removed.

Safety at a school allows kids to look forward to being in an encouraging environment. This, in turn, promotes social and creative learning. By any chance, if their safety is not met, children are at constant risk and absenteeism may rise. Promoting school safety creates an open space for kids to learn and explore new things. Breach of school security puts the lives of students, teachers, and administrators in danger and also affects the parents’ community at large. It leaves a significant impact on the quality of learning and can also lead to poor reputation and lawsuits. So, it is the responsibility of the school administration to find ways to make schools highly secure and safe for all the students and their staff. Also, parents are equally responsible for selecting the right space for their kids. They can analyze everything around and within the school before planning the admission of their kid.

Factors to watch out for determining the safety in a school

Limited entryways to the building: There should be only one main entrance to the school for kids, staff as well as visitors. The rest access doors must be locked and checked periodically to ensure that they haven’t been tampered with. Periodic inspections of the windows should be done to ensure that no one can enter or cause harm to the kids or the school building. Parents can have a visit and check this thing properly.

Monitoring by the school of parking 24X7 by an armed security guard: You should consider whether the school is monitoring the activities of the parking lot such as people leaving and entering.

Monitoring of common areas: Student common areas, for instance, activity rooms, hallways, and playgrounds should be monitored and video surveillance of these areas is a must to not miss anything.

Quality professional security officials: Maintaining the presence of school resource officers or security is also an important measure towards improving security. You can research about it and analyze the school on that basis.

Monitoring of visitors’ logs: It should be made mandatory for all visitors to check-in at the main reception or security desk, sign in and wear badges assigned to visitors. The training of the security staff should be to look out for strangers roaming in school premises without badges. Any suspicious activity must be reported to security immediately. Parents can observe these things by visiting the school regularly.

Conduct threat and risk assessment: Proper procedures need to be defined and assessment should be conducted through specialized teams. Drills for staff and students must be held from time to time to ensure that everyone knows how to respond in case such a situation arises.

Reviewing emergency plans and protocols: School’s emergency plans and preparedness procedures such as lockdown, evacuation, and communication procedures must be shared with the staff, students, and parents. Schools must provide training to everyone regarding how to respond to such emergencies. You should consider these characteristics as important for the safety of your kid.

Make students part of the security maintenance system: Kids should be encouraged to take part in maintaining the school’s security and schools must take their feedback from parents from time to time to update their security measures. Schools can encourage this by anonymous reporting and providing kids with teachers who have access to these systems. Sometimes kids are unable to communicate with people due to the fear of judgment. Allow them to talk to people anonymously. Toddlers are not that capable, so it is the responsibility of their parents to communicate these demands to the management of the school.

Fewer resource personnel: The responsibility of locking and unlocking the school’s buildings should be assigned to a limited number of people. Parents can check whether the school ensures strict protocols for key control or not. The number of people who have access to the keys should be documented along with their personal information.

We all are aware that fostering creativity is one of the greatest challenges faced by most people. Creativity in students blooms when the teachers create an ecosystem for creativity that can frequently spill over to their homes and future lives. Parents can try and be aware of the tips and tricks, and games and activities that help in improving the vocabulary of the kids using creativity and innovative tools.

As a parent, you should always keep searching for creative ways to improve your students’ vocabulary. Here are some of them for you.

Vocabulary Exercises 

It is one of the best strategies that are used by most parents and teachers across the world. Ask kids to find the vocab words they study in class and in the books they read. You will see, this would be a great push for all of them to start reading more in their leisure time. They will end up getting exposed to a lot of words.

The vocabulary exercise is a unique example of a simple yet innovative strategy that parents can apply for their kids to make learning fun, especially for a long-term exercise such as building kids’ vocabulary. The idea behind this is to make kids read more so they can be introduced to new words and naturally learn their usage and the context they generally occur in.

As we know, developing vocabulary requires memorizing their spellings, conjugations, and pronunciations. It also involves the understanding of their usage in different contexts, especially for some words that have more than one meaning. All of these aspects of vocabulary development demand a combination of rote learning and understanding the meanings of words.

Use Flashcards

Flashcards can turn out to be a very effective tool to master the rote-learning aspect of words and ensure that they stick in your kids’ memory. Parents can use flashcards for organizing quizzes for the kids. This is just one out of many examples in which flashcards can be used. Flashcards have multiple applications, and there are several flashcard apps available online as well.  

Teach Correct Pronunciations

Teachers and parents often complain that pronunciation is one of the toughest skills to get their students enthusiastic about. Students are introduced to new words not only in their language class but also in other classes such as science, social studies, and mathematics as they read their textbooks. But the subject teachers don’t always teach the correct way to say a word or the technical jargon, and often, these pronunciation errors get carried into students’ adult lives. Therefore, it is crucial to inculcate in them the habit of learning the correct pronunciation along with the meaning and usage of the word, so they become self-sufficient learners as they grow.

One of the key tricks to tell the students about English is that it is not a phonetic language, that is to say, English words are not always pronounced the way they are spelt. You may teach this by giving examples of the same alphabet that gives different sounds. For example, the letter “e” is used to denote different sounds in “egg”, “he”, and “item”.

Buy some mnemonic tools

With visually appealing word maps and pronunciation guides helping students in learning and memorizing most words, some tough ones require an additional memory aid. Mnemonics are very helpful and handy here. Any memory tool that we use to help us remember difficult concepts is a mnemonic. For example, “VIBGYOR” is a common acronym used to remember the colors of the rainbow, Violet, Indigo, Blue, Green, Yellow, Orange, and Red.

Memorizing difficult words by coming up with mnemonics can be a great class activity. Creating a virtual mental picture like this to associate the words with their meaning can help your kids memorize the word better. Once the kids make their mnemonics for the assigned words, ask them to share them with you and have fun embellishing their mnemonic stories.

Make them learn some root words, prefixes, and suffixes

Knowing root words, prefixes, and suffixes can vastly improve your kids’ vocabulary. It is because the combination of these few words can form many more words, and learning the meanings of these few words can give your kids an idea about the meanings of others. For example, learning the meaning of the root word “bene” which means “good” can give your students a hint about the meanings of benediction, benefactor, beneficent, beneficial, benefit, benevolent, and many more. All of these words have varying meanings that are related to “good”.

After teaching your kids a few root words, prefixes, and suffixes, assign them some root words, prefixes, and suffixes and ask them to list as many words as they can for each of these words.

Parents have several issues to tackle while raising a child. Firstly, managing the workload, then selecting the right school for early education, and once they get a school they have the burden of something they’re not prepared for until they plan it. Kids can be stubborn and the change they experience when they go to school can turn out to be difficult for parents to comprehend. Other than these issues parents have to cope up with the challenge of their kid’s homework. Preschools are designed keeping in mind the techniques and methods that can make the learning and activities of a kid easy but parents can’t afford to do so. As a result, it turns out to be a challenge for them. But, there’s always a way that takes you out of the dark towards the light if you try and wish to do so. So, the parents can structure their routine and make homework easy for the kid and themselves too. They can take inspiration from the preschools and act accordingly.

Here are a few tips that can allow making homework a fun experience for kids

 

Work together as a Team

Everyone enjoys getting assisted and working in a team. Your kid needs assistance not just because he/she needs help but it helps their mental space as well. You can do your work alongside your kid and make him/her feel comfortable. You can do your tasks related to your work and your kid will be engaged in the homework. Help them out in case of any query but let them do the homework on their own. Preschools have always been doing this, the teachers at the school perform their roles in the activities but let the kids do the tasks associated with it. It helps kids in learning and mental growth well which allows them to get into the habit of doing their work.

Award your kid for small things 

Children love gifts and surprises and it can be an easy game to persuade them by rewarding them when they do something with discipline and control. You can give them toffees, chocolates after they complete the homework, or promise them a ride or a trip to a familiar place on the weekends. This might motivate them to do well and you can happily give them the things they want. Nursery Schools follow the routine of awarding children when they actively take part in the daily activities which motivates them to do well and participate regularly.

Make them visualize the Tasks

Visuals are always better than words or oral explanations. Try to make a chart for your child that makes them understand the tasks they need to perform daily. It will also help the child in remembering what tasks lie ahead of them and they will not skip any of the homework. You can also keep a record of the work that your child has done throughout the day. You can also ask your child to draw a homework chart as it will give them an idea about their tasks and make them involved in creation and art as well. You can award the child for that too. Preschools have the culture of maintaining such charts not only for the tasks but for the achievements that a child gets during any sports or activities.

Get Outside the house and make it a game

You can take your kid outside the house in any ground or space that allows them to be free and be in an atmosphere that has positive vibes. You can make the homework any activity and game for the kid which increases their interest and involvement in the homework. It can also be refreshing for the child after a long day at school. This will enhance their confidence and concentration in their homework. Parents can utilize the atmosphere to make them learn new things as well.

The early stage of a child’s life is the best time for not just learning basic skills but learning how to build relationships. The quality and practice of building relationships with peers are necessary for anyone to be active in society which helps in the mental growth of the individual. Once a child gets actively indulged in making friends and other communication connections it helps him/her throughout life. We are part of society and communication is the medium that makes us express what we think and this behavior of a person is hugely dependent on the activities they do during their childhood. A preschool is an appropriate space to build a child’s communication powers and thus forming relations with friends and society. There are a number of kids involved in fun activities at a preschool together and share their thoughts and ideas with the guidance of teachers. It helps them in getting evolved in a smoother way and lays the base for their future communication skills as well.

Some important advantages that making friends provides to a kid are:

Communication Skills

Interacting is the best and fun experience in a friendship for kids. There can’t be better learning of communication and interaction than being with friends because kids are comfortable sharing what’s on their minds with their friends. Kids explore several things when they play together and communicate in many mediums and everything adds to their skills while learning as they are fresh and raw. If a kid is alone and doesn’t have friends, it will surely reflect in his/her behavior after growing up. Social skills will diminish continuously and it might affect mental health as well. Preschools are the right place to make kids learn the art of interacting and making friends from scratch because of the fun environment and atmosphere suitable for kids.

Compassion

Kids learn every moral value during their childhood, it is the best time to teach them as much as possible because once they grow up they have those learnings as their habits. Kids learn to respect others and their decisions while playing in a group, they start developing human feelings when they make friends which is an important characteristic of a person’s life. Friendships make children learn to understand others’ feelings as well and they try to respond in a respectful manner.

Cogitation

Children learn a lot with new friends and can take away several characters from each one of them. Along with that a kid is made familiar with cogitation and enhances his/her thinking capabilities. They learn basic manners because of the children around them. They learn to be helpful because of the emotions related to a friendship and use kind terms like please, sorry, etc. A child who is isolated and doesn’t have friends might take a lot of time to grasp such understanding and skills.

Playing Skills

Sports and games are mostly group activities especially during the learning phase of a kid. They can learn to be actively involved in these activities because of their friends and compete in a delightful manner. Kids can also try a variety of activities and games because their friends are participating in them. This leads to the growth of kids’ learning and knowledge along with physical and mental growth.

Patience

Patience is the key to success in several aspects of life, especially in games and activities of a kids’ school. Friends teach several life lessons that reflect in the habits of a person and patience is one of them. When kids are involved in any activity or games they wait for their turn and learn to share their things and emotions if they are playing in a team.
